- Dictionarycane/kān/
noun
- 1. the hollow jointed stem of a tall grass, especially bamboo or sugar cane, or the stem of a slender palm such as rattan.
- 2. a length of cane or a slender stick, especially one used as a support for plants, as a walking stick, or as an instrument of punishment: "tie the shoot to a cane if vertical growth is required" Similar
verb
- 1. beat with a cane as a punishment.

noun. a stick or short staff used to assist one in walking; walking stick. a long, hollow or pithy, jointed woody stem, as that of bamboo, rattan, sugarcane, and certain palms. a plant having such a stem. split rattan woven or interlaced for chair seats, wickerwork, etc.

any of several tall bamboolike grasses, especially of the genus Arundinaria, as A. gigantea (cane reed, large cane, giant cane, or southern cane) and A. tecta (small cane, or switch cane), of the southern United States.
